The Moore Maker Trapper 5202M is a traditional Trapper pocket knife that combines classic ranch knife utility with genuine Mesquite wood handle scales and heritage slipjoint craftsmanship. Built on the iconic Trapper pattern, the 5202M features the traditional dual-blade configuration of a clip point blade paired with a spey blade. Originally developed for trapping, livestock work, and ranch utility tasks, this versatile blade combination remains one of the most recognizable and practical traditional pocket knife patterns for everyday carry and working use. This version is fitted with genuine Mesquite wood handles, giving the knife a warm natural appearance deeply connected to Southwestern and Texas ranch heritage. Mesquite is valued for its dense structure, distinctive grain character, and rugged durability, making it especially fitting for a traditional ranch-style pocket knife. The natural wood scales provide unique variation in grain and coloration, giving each knife its own individual character. The knife utilizes traditional non-locking slipjoint construction, preserving the classic walk-and-talk action appreciated by collectors and traditional knife enthusiasts alike.

Specifications
Blade Steel: 1095
Blade Shape: Clip Point/Spey
Blade Finish: Polished
Blade Length: 3.25"
Overall Length: 7.38"
Handle Length: 4.13"
Handle Material: Mesquite Wood
Handle Finish: Wood
Locking Mechanism: Slip Joint
Weight: 3.70oz
Country of Origin: USA
